What is Ameris Bancorp's banking division — noninterest expense?
Ameris Bancorp (ABCB) reported banking division — noninterest expense of $116.42M in Q1 2026.
How has Ameris Bancorp's banking division — noninterest expense changed year-over-year?
Ameris Bancorp's banking division — noninterest expense increased by 4.3% year-over-year, from $111.6M to $116.42M.
What is the long-term trend for Ameris Bancorp's banking division — noninterest expense?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Ameris Bancorp's banking division — noninterest expense has grown at a 8.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$322.19M to $440.84M.
What does banking division — noninterest expense mean?
This metric represents the aggregate of all operating expenses, excluding interest expense, required to run the banking segment. It is a primary measure of the bank's operational efficiency and cost management discipline.
